Kinds Of Volkswagen Keys
| Key Type | Description | Security Features |
|---|---|---|
| Standard Mechanical Key | Standard metal key utilized in older Volkswagen models | Simple cut design, very little theft security |
| Remote Key Fob | Key fob with buttons for locking and opening doors | Transmitter technology, rolling code |
| Smart Key/ Keyless Entry Key | Key fob that enables for keyless entry and ignition | Advanced file encryption, distance detection |
| Integrated Key Blade | Key fob with a retractable metal key used for emergency situations | Integrates standard and keyless features |
Features of Volkswagen Keys
Volkswagen keys come equipped with many functions designed to enhance user benefit and car security. Below are a few of the highlights:
- Remote Lock/Unlock: Most modern-day Volkswagen keys enable users to lock and open their automobiles from a distance, including a layer of benefit.
- Panic Button: A built-in panic feature enables motorists to trigger the car's alarm in case of an emergency.
- Trunk Release Button: Many Volkswagen models feature a trunk release button, making it easy to access the trunk even when your hands are full.
- Keyless Entry and Start: A significant function of the wise key system is the capability to unlock or start the car without physically placing the key, provided the key fob is within a particular range.
- Transponder Technology: Most Volkswagen keys include a transponder chip that interacts with the car's ignition system, making sure that just licensed keys can begin the engine.
- Personalization Options: Depending on the model, owners might have the ability to customize functions associated with their keys, such as adjusting the remote start duration.
Typical Key Issues
While Volkswagen keys are developed with toughness and performance in mind, users may encounter numerous issues in time. Here are some common issues associated with Volkswagen keys:
| Issue | Description | Solution |
|---|---|---|
| Key Not Detected | The automobile stops working to recognize the key | Examine battery, reprogram or change key |
| Key Battery Depletion | The key fob battery may run low, affecting performance | Replace the key fob battery |
| Key Blade Damage | Physical wear and tear on the key blade | Go to a locksmith for key replacement |
| Lost or Stolen Key | Troubles in accessing the automobile | Contact dealership for key replacement |
| Key Programming Failures | Concerns in setting new keys can happen | Professional help needed |

2. Can I cut a Volkswagen key from a copy?
It's usually not advised to cut a Volkswagen key from a copy. Most modern keys include transponder chips, and cutting a physical key will not make sure that it operates your car without correct programs.
3. What should I do if my key fob is not working?
If your key fob is not functioning, initially try changing the battery. If that doesn't work, reprogramming or replacing the key fob may be necessary. Consulting with your regional dealership or a certified locksmith is advisable.
4. Exists a way to open my Volkswagen without a key?
In an emergency circumstance where keys are locked within, many Volkswagen models include a manual key that can be utilized to unlock the motorist's side door. If you're locked out, get in touch with a locksmith professional or VW roadside assistance.
5. How typically should I replace my key fob battery?
It is usually advised to change your key fob battery every 2-3 years, depending on usage. However, if you observe a decrease in functionality, changing the battery quicker is suggested.
